Lot 344:
Description
This lot comprises two pieces of Wedgwood jasperware stoneware accompanied by original packaging and ephemera. The first item is a heart-shaped trinket dish featuring a pale blue ground with white sprigged bas-relief decoration. The central motif depicts a classical female figure holding a garland, encircled by an oak leaf and acorn border. The base is impressed with the mark WEDGWOOD followed by a copyright symbol, MADE IN ENGLAND, and the characters CG and 68. The second item is a circular commemorative dish or coaster featuring a dark blue ground. The central white bas-relief decoration depicts a profile portrait of Queen Elizabeth II above a banner inscribed 1952 SILVER JUBILEE 1977, all within a laurel leaf border. The base is impressed with the mark WEDGWOOD followed by a copyright symbol, MADE IN ENGLAND, and the characters CO and 76. The lot includes an original purple Wedgwood presentation box with a patterned lid and a commemorative pamphlet titled The Queen’s Silver Jubilee 1952-1977.
Heart-shaped dish: 112mm x 105mm
Circular dish: 112mm diameter.
